Many of the
co-products generated in the food, food ingredient, and fuel
alcohol industries are utilized in livestock and poultry feeds and
pet foods. From soybean meal to distillers’ grains, from corn
steep liquor to soy molasses, these co-products can be
successfully used as individual ingredients in livestock or
poultry feed or pet food formulation. This is the traditional use
for these ingredients. With our Research Team of nutritionists,
feed technologists, engineers, chemists, microbiologists, and
biochemists, we are working on projects that will blend specific
co-products to create specialty ingredients. These specialty
ingredients will add value to the individual co-products and
benefit ADM and our clients.
ADM began this process through the initial development of HFP.
Our nutritionists and feed technologists are evaluating additional
uses of HFP beyond use in dairy rations. Similar use enhancements
are being pursued with natural-source vitamin E. Super SoyTM
was developed to create a cost-effective alternative to soybean
meal through the use of soybean co-products and lysine.
Additional project teams are actively pursuing the use and blends
of various liquid co-products for use in ruminant feeds. As we
become more familiar with these liquid co-products and their
nutritional and physical handling characteristics, we will
initiate projects examining blends of liquid and dry co-products.
We are beginning to investigate the nutritional benefits of
various fermentation co-products and what applications are most
appropriate in animal feeds and pet foods. CitriStim™ is the
first example of a commercial product developed through our
fermentation co-products research efforts. Others will follow. In addition to Nutreon®,
other co-product blends are being investigated as potential
antioxidants.

Among the
resources that ADM provides Alliance Nutrition, the financial
resources are essential to effectively grow our business and
support product development initiatives. The commitment by the
Archer Daniels Midland Company to invest in the Ruminant Intensive
Research Unit reflects the strength of Proven Performance from
Innovative Nutrition and the future direction of our research
program. It consists of 24 stalls for individual feeding of
either growing or lactating cattle, an exercise lot, and
multiple commodity storage bays and tanks for ADM co-products.
Six of the stalls will facilitate quantitative manure collection
for nutrient balance studies designed to best formulate
Eco-Nutrition beef and dairy feeding programs. A primary focus
for the studies conducted at the unit utilizes
sophisticated in-situ and in-vitro techniques to determine the
nutrient content, related feeding value, and best use for ADM
liquid and dry ingredients as well as associated ingredient
blends.
Improvements at our Beef Research Center have expanded our
replication capabilities for cow-calf and stocker research
evaluating protein/mineral range supplements and co-product applications.
Major renovations of the Feed Technology Research Center during
2005 have enabled us to utilize modular equipment in the
development of new feed manufacturing processes and expand the
pilot plant capabilities of the center.
